主页/WordPress笔记/博客文章/综合文章/13个最佳WordPress多站点插件(专家推荐)

13个最佳WordPress多站点插件(专家推荐)

写 Bug工程师:

在当今的互联网世界中,拥有多个网站管理起来确实是一项挑战。而多站点功能正是解决这一问题的关键。它允许您创建和管理多个独立但相关的网站,从而提高组织效率并节省时间。WordPress作为全球最流行的博客平台之一,自然拥有了众多优秀的多站点插件来满足不同用户的需求。以下是根据您的需求推荐的13个优秀WordPress多站点插件:

1. MultiSite Pro

  • 功能: 提供强大的多站点管理和监控工具。
  • 优点: 完整的多站点解决方案,包括自动更新、备份和日志记录。

安装步骤:

wp plugin install multisite-pro --activate

效果: 开启后,您可以轻松地添加新站点,查看所有站点的状态,以及管理它们的数据。

2. Multisite Manager

  • 功能: 简化多站点管理过程。
  • 优点: 易于使用的界面,帮助快速添加和管理多站点。

安装步骤:

wp plugin install multisite-manager --activate

效果: 使用此插件,您可以直观地看到各个站点的内容和活动,无需复杂的配置。

3. Networked Media Gallery

  • 功能: 创建和共享多媒体内容。
  • 优点: 允许用户上传、分享和管理各种媒体文件。

安装步骤:

wp plugin install networked-media-gallery --activate

效果: 用户可以方便地上传图片、视频等多媒体内容,并通过内置的社交分享功能与他人共享这些资源。

4. WP Super Cache

  • 功能: 实现高效缓存以加速页面加载速度。
  • 优点: 支持多种缓存策略,提升用户体验。

安装步骤:

wp plugin install wp-super-cache --activate

效果: 在启用WP Super Cache后,您的网站访问速度会显著提高,用户等待的时间更短。

5. Jetpack

  • 功能: 扩展WordPress的功能,提供全面的社交媒体集成和分析工具。
  • 优点: 拥有丰富的社区支持和持续更新。

安装步骤:

wp plugin install jetpack --activate

效果: 使用Jetpack,您可以连接到Facebook、Twitter和其他社交媒体平台,同时获取详细的流量分析报告。

6. Easy Digital Downloads

  • 功能: 管理数字产品和订阅服务。
  • 优点: 提供简单易用的数字产品发布和管理功能。

安装步骤:

wp plugin install easy-digital-downloads --activate

效果: 企业或个人可以通过Easy Digital Downloads发布电子书、教程、软件包等,为用户提供便捷的服务体验。

7. Advanced Custom Fields (ACF)

  • 功能: 添加自定义字段到WordPress文章和页面。
  • 优点: 增强内容管理灵活性,适用于复杂定制需求。

安装步骤:

wp plugin install advanced-custom-fields --activate

效果: ACF允许您在WordPress文章和页面中添加各种自定义字段,如颜色、字体大小等,大大增强了内容的丰富性和个性化。

8. Yoast SEO

  • 功能: 提升SEO性能。
  • 优点: 自动优化标题、元描述等关键元素,减少手动调整工作量。

安装步骤:

wp plugin install yoast-seo --activate

效果: 使用Yoast SEO,您的网站SEO表现将会得到显著改善,搜索排名更高,吸引更多的潜在客户。

9. Gravity Forms

  • 功能: 创建表单和注册系统。
  • 优点: 可用于收集数据、调查反馈等,简化在线表单处理。

安装步骤:

wp plugin install gravity-forms --activate

效果: Gravity Forms使得创建个性化的在线表单变得非常容易,无论是问卷调查还是会员注册都绰绰有余。

10. BuddyPress

  • 功能: 构建社交网络环境。
  • 优点: 能够整合用户的社交网络关系,促进社区互动。

安装步骤:

wp plugin install buddypress --activate

效果: 如果您的网站主要面向社群,BuddyPress可以帮助建立一个活跃的社区空间,让用户更容易地交流和合作。

11. WPML

  • 功能: 支持多语言网站。
  • 优点: 真正实现跨语言网站的无缝操作,提高国际化能力。

安装步骤:

wp plugin install wpmu-multilingual-composer --activate

效果: WPML允许您轻松切换不同的语言版本,这对于跨国公司或者希望扩展其全球影响力的企业来说尤为重要。

12. All in One WP Migration

  • 功能: 数据迁移工具。
  • 优点: 方便地从旧服务器迁移到新的服务器,确保数据安全无误。

安装步骤:

wp plugin install all-in-one-wp-migration --activate

效果: 这款插件使数据迁移变得极为简便,无论是在测试环境中还是正式上线前,都可以放心地进行。

13. Ultimate Member

  • 功能: 提供会员管理系统。
  • 优点: 集成了支付功能和会员积分体系,增加网站吸引力。

安装步骤:

wp plugin install ultimate-member --activate

效果: Ultimate Member不仅提供了基本的会员登录和管理功能,还能结合第三方支付网关,让网站具备更强大的经济激励机制。

以上就是我们为您精心挑选的13个优秀WordPress多站点插件,它们各有特色,能很好地满足不同场景下的需求。选择合适的插件不仅能提升您的网站性能和用户体验,也能增强网站的安全性。现在就去尝试一下吧!

黑板IDE教书匠:

好的,下面我将为你详细介绍13个最佳WordPress多站点插件,以及如何使用它们来管理你的网站。

1. WP Multisite

介绍: WP Multisite 是一个强大的插件,允许你在单个WordPress部署上创建多个网站。它支持无限的网站和用户数量,可以轻松地管理多个网站的配置、内容和安全性。

示例代码:

add_action('init', 'multisite_init');
function multisite_init() {
    register_multisite();
}
function register_multisite() {
    $args = array(
        'name' => 'My Multi-Site',
        'url' => '',
        'domain' => '',
        'admin_name' => 'My Admin Name',
        'admin_email' => 'myemail@example.com',
        'description' => 'This is my multi-site setup'
    );
    wp_register_multisite($args);
    // Register child sites
    foreach (get_sites() as $site) {
        if ($site->parent == 0) {
            continue;
        }
        wp_create_child_site($site->blog_id, $site->domain . '/' . $site->name);
    }
}

2. WP Super Cache

介绍: WP Super Cache 是一个非常实用的插件,它可以加速WordPress网站的速度并减少服务器负载。

示例代码:

// 加载 WP Super Cache 插件
require_once ABSPATH . 'wp-admin/includes/plugin.php';
register_activation_hook(__FILE__, 'wpsupercache_activation');
function wpsupercache_activation() {
    wp_cache_set('default', 'enabled', 'default', 60 * 5);
    wp_cache_set('posts', 'enabled', 'default', 60 * 5);
    wp_cache_set('pages', 'enabled', 'default', 60 * 5);
    wp_cache_set('comments', 'enabled', 'default', 60 * 5);
    wp_cache_set('meta', 'enabled', 'default', 60 * 5);
    wp_cache_set('post_types', 'enabled', 'default', 60 * 5);
    wp_cache_set('users', 'enabled', 'default', 60 * 5);
    wp_cache_set('tags', 'enabled', 'default', 60 * 5);
    wp_cache_set('categories', 'enabled', 'default', 60 * 5);
    wp_cache_set('posts_per_page', 'enabled', 'default', 60 * 5);
    wp_cache_set('archive_posts', 'enabled', 'default', 60 * 5);
    wp_cache_set('archive_pages', 'enabled', 'default', 60 * 5);
    wp_cache_set('archive_comments', 'enabled', 'default', 60 * 5);
}

// 设置缓存过期时间
set_transient_time_limit(60 * 60 * 24); // 一天缓存一次

3. WP Rocket

介绍: WP Rocket 是另一个优秀的加速器插件,可以帮助提高网站速度。

示例代码:

add_action('plugins_loaded', function () {
    add_filter('template_include', 'rocket_template_include');
});
function rocket_template_include($template) {
    return apply_filters('rocket/rewrite/template', $template);
}

4. WP Super Admin

介绍: WP Super Admin 提供了对网站更高级别的控制功能,包括安全设置和权限管理。

示例代码:

add_action('admin_menu', 'super_admin_menu');
function super_admin_menu() {
    add_options_page('Super Admin', 'Super Admin', 'manage_options', 'super_admin', 'super_admin_settings');
}
function super_admin_settings() {
    // 配置选项
}

5. WPML

介绍: WPML 是一个多语言插件,允许您为您的网站提供多种语言版本。

示例代码:

// 安装 WPML 插件
install_plugin(array('plugin_name'));

总结:

以上就是13个最佳WordPress多站点插件,每种插件都有其独特的功能和应用场景。你可以根据自己的需求选择合适的插件来优化你的网站性能和用户体验。希望这些信息对你有所帮助!